Custom firmware alters the console’s operating system to remove restrictions imposed by Nintendo. The most popular and robust CFW ecosystem for the DSi is , which works in tandem with Unlaunch (a bootloader exploit) and Twilight Menu++ (a custom interface). If a console's system files become corrupted due to a failed update or improper modding, re-flashing the original firmware can bring the device back to life.
Advanced users sometimes download firmware from different regions to change their console's system language or bypass regional restrictions.
